Kalshi’s $1 Billion Milestone: A New Era in Prediction Markets
Key Takeaways
- Kalshi recently secured $1 billion in a funding round, elevating its valuation to $11 billion.
- The funding round featured major investors such as Sequoia Capital and CapitalG, with participation from other renowned firms like Andreessen Horowitz.
- Kalshi operates as a CFTC-regulated exchange, distinguishing itself from its decentralized, crypto-native competitor, Polymarket.
- The prediction market is experiencing rapid growth, attracting significant investor interest due to its blend of financial speculation and news-driven engagement.
- Kalshi’s regulated model offers legal clarity and fiat access, appealing to institutional and retail traders aiming for more structured and compliant trading options.
Introduction to Kalshi and Its Position in Prediction Markets
In the bustling world of prediction markets, Kalshi has emerged as a formidable player. Recently, the company raised a whopping $1 billion in a funding round, which catapulted its valuation to an impressive $11 billion (as of November 2025). This achievement brings it within striking distance of Polymarket, a key competitor whose valuation target is reportedly between $12 billion and $15 billion.
Kalshi’s model is distinct in the marketplace. It operates as a regulated exchange under the oversight of the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C), setting it apart from other platforms that adopt decentralized models. This regulation aligns with Kalshi’s goal of providing institutional and retail traders with a U.S.-compliant exchange that offers legal certainty and fiat onramps.

Comparing Kalshi and Polymarket
Kalshi and Polymarket, despite operating within the same industry, offer contrasting models. Kalshi’s platform focuses on regulatory compliance and structured operations to cater to traders who demand legal clarity and traditional financial access points. This approach appeals particularly to institutional investors and those who prioritize regulatory assurance. On the other hand, Polymarket is entrenched in the decentralized paradigm, relying on blockchain technology to facilitate a marketplace where users can bet on binary outcomes using cryptocurrency. This decentralized approach is favored by users who value transparency and resistance to censorship.
While both platforms have carved their niches, the competition signifies a larger trend where financial innovation meets regulatory frameworks, each with its own strengths and challenges.
